One thing I noticed in the game, for some reason yesterday it really stood out to me about JP (especially after watching Brady). When he drops back to pass, he has the "quick feet" drops back really fast seemingly a different pace each time. The ball is also pretty high (compared to other Qb's) If you watch Brady he drops back at a much slower (calmer) pace and is much more balanced when he makes the throw. JP seems to be rushing and off balance much of the time.
The obvious thing too he is holding onto the ball way too long, I know much of that is on the receivers not getting open. He also does not have the confidence in his receivers making the play (like Brady on his TD where he threw into the open space and WR made a great play to the ball) JP seems to force it in there.
I guess what I am saying he is not fluid when he drops back I think that is causing many of his problems.
